Apprentice Gas/Plumbing
Mansfield District Council has an exciting opportunity for someone to join their trade repairs team based at Mansfield Woodhouse to gain first-hand experience of day-to-day maintenance tasks whilst undertaking a Gas - Plumbing Apprenticeship.
-
What will the apprentice be doing?
Undertake on-site training alongside a qualified engineer to install, repair, service, and maintain domestic heating systems, hot/cold water systems, central heating, above-ground drainage, and
rainwater systems.Assist with accurate measuring, marking, cutting, bending, and jointing of metallic and non- metallic pipework and fittings.
Develop the technical knowledge to support the team with boiler servicing, appliance maintenance, plant room improvements, water heaters, and commercial gas appliances.
Understand support, installation and maintenance of green environmental technologies, including heat pumps, solar thermal systems, biomass boilers, and water recycling setups.
Assist the team with planned preventative maintenance (PPM) schedules, gas safety compliance checks, and reactive repairs within set time frames to meet statutory requirements.
Carry out general plumbing duties and alterations to pipework while learning to identify, manage, and mitigate legionella and asbestos risks.
Accurately complete required college documentation, coursework, and workplace logs to specified deadlines, attending regular progress reviews with the apprentice advisor.
Maintain, clean, and verify the safety of any allocated transport, tools, uniform, and personal protective equipment (PPE) supplied by the council.
Minimise disruption, mess, and dust to the customer’s home, ensuring all properties are left in a clean, tidy, and safe condition upon completion of works.
Proactively manage and load coursework, assignments, and evidence logs onto college monitoring platforms (e.g., Smart Assessor) within designated deadlines.
